"Extremely Rare" Pansa Denarius, RBW 1286?
« on: June 28, 2017, 09:17:54 am »
C. Vibius C.f. Pansa, AR Denarius, 3.38g, Laureate head of Apollo right, PANSA behind, control mark below chin (?) / Minerva in fast quadriga holding spear and reins in left hand, trophy in right, C VIBIVS C F in exergue. Babelon Vibia 2 var.; Crawford342/5a; RBW 1286 ("extremely rare variety"). Ex. Forvm.

Is my attribution correct?  RBW's is in better condition but doesn't show the control mark.
